Follow this structured approach to achieve a flawless result. <table border="1" cellpadding="10" cellspacing="0" style="width:100%; border-collapse: collapse; margin-bottom: 20px;"> <thead> <tr> <th scope="col">Stage</th> <th scope="col">Key Action</th> <th scope="col">Duration</th> </tr> </thead> <tbody> <tr> <td><strong>Subfloor Assessment & Repair</strong></td> <td>Inspect existing floor, remove damaged sections, repair structural weaknesses, sand smooth surfaces</td> <td 1–2 days</td> </tr> <tr> <td><strong>Moisture & Insulation Check</strong></td> <td>Test subfloor for moisture, install vapor barrier, add closed-cell foam insulation</td> <td 1 day</td> </tr> <tr> <td><strong>Underlayment Installation</strong></td> <td>Lay high-density foam underlayment to ensure stability and thermal performance</td> <td 1 day</td> </tr> <tr> <td><strong>Floor Covering Application</strong></td> <td>Install chosen material—whether engineered hardwood, luxury vinyl, or tile—with proper expansion joints</td> <td 2–5 days</td> </tr> <tr> <td><strong>Finishing Touches & Sealing</strong></td> <td>Apply edge trim, baseboards, and seal grout lines or seams for durability</td> <td 1 day</td> </tr> </tbody> </table> Each phase builds on the last, ensuring structural integrity and aesthetic continuity from base to ceiling. <h2>Choosing the Right Materials for Long-Lasting Performance</h2> Selecting flooring and underlayment materials tailored to Fargo’s climate is essential for longevity and comfort. Consider these top options: <ul> <li><strong>Engineered Hardwood:</strong> Resists moisture better than solid wood, ideal for humid winters with stable indoor climate control.</li> <li><strong>Luxury Vinyl Plank (LVP):</strong> Water-resistant surface, easy to clean, and available in authentic wood-look finishes perfect for Fargo’s modern homes.</li> <li><strong>Closed-Cell Foam Underlayment:</strong> Provides excellent insulation, reduces noise, and prevents moisture migration beneath the floor.</li> <li><strong>Ceramic or Porcelain Tile:</strong> Durable and waterproof, best suited for high-traffic areas or basements with moisture risk.</li> </ul> Matching material properties to environmental conditions ensures your floor remains beautiful and functional year-round. <p class="pro-note">Note: Always verify product ratings for freeze-thaw resistance and moisture tolerance before final selection.</p> <h2>Practical Tips for a Seamless Floor-to-Ceiling Finish</h2> To elevate your upgrade beyond basic installation, implement these practical strategies: - Use expansion joints every 8–10 feet to accommodate thermal movement without cracking. - Maintain consistent subfloor flatness—uneven surfaces compromise both appearance and safety. - Seal grout lines or tile edges with silicone caulk to prevent water infiltration in wet zones. - Choose finishes with UV stability if exposed to windows, though Fargo’s indoor focus reduces this need. - Plan for maintenance: regular sweeping and occasional resealing extend service life significantly. <p class="pro-note">Note: Professional installation often yields superior results, especially when integrating complex underlayment systems.</p> <h2>Final Thoughts: Crafting a Timeless Floor-to-Ceiling Space in Fargo, ND</h2> A *perfect floor-to-ceiling* installation in Fargo, ND is more than a renovation—it’s an investment in comfort, durability, and timeless design.
